Conservation
Vacuum weekly, suction only. Rotate the rug end for end every six months so foot traffic and natural light age the surface evenly. Blot spills with a dry cotton cloth and follow with cool water on a second pass. Hand-wash by a wool-trained conservator every five years. Day-to-day care
- Vacuum gently once a week without a rotating brush bar — use the suction-only setting on hand-knotted or hand-tufted pieces.
- Rotate the rug 180° every 3-6 months so foot traffic and sunlight wear is even.
- Use a quality rug pad underneath for slip resistance and to extend life.
- Blot fresh spills immediately with a clean white cloth — do not rub. Work from the edge of the spill inward.
Deep cleaning
- Professional dry-cleaning is recommended every 12-24 months for hand-knotted carpets.
- Avoid steam cleaners and hot water on natural-fibre rugs (wool, silk, jute) — they can cause shrinkage and dye bleeding.
- For washable flat-weaves and cotton dhurries, machine-wash on a gentle cold cycle in a mesh bag.
Storage
- Roll (do not fold) the carpet around a clean cardboard tube, pile-side in.
- Wrap in breathable cotton sheeting (not plastic) and store in a cool, dry, well-ventilated space.
- Use moth-protection sachets if storing wool for more than a season.
